编写高质量代码的书评 (28)

Whyme Lyu 2010-07-24 20:20:47

站书店翻了一下 吹个毛求个疵

P48 原文说(CSS中的)common层等于MVC中的M 这何必...CSS又不是什么可程序化的东西, 何必非要跟这个词去套近乎. P53~54 双倍margin的现象是: IE6中左浮动那么左margin会双倍, 右浮动那么右margin会双倍. 原文没有明确说明左右. P81~82 CSS的权重不能简单地说"HTML选择符是1, ...  (展开)
justin 2010-07-11 22:05:27

读过了,这是作者的一本实践经验总结

读到100页,刚发现一个问题,质量还不错,后续有再补充。 虽然“XXX修炼之道”有点儿标题党,不过书的内容还可以,还是值得一读的,推荐阅读。    P82:第四行: 原文:color应该是green 纠正:color应该是red P1:最后一行(from keke): 原文:提前... 纠正:提高... 2010...  (展开)
creep 2012-02-16 18:44:14

借来或蹲书店花几个小时过一遍就行了

1、大面积的代码和截图有凑篇幅之嫌 2、校订不认真很多印刷/书写错误 3、像是自己的wiki整理后给出版了 4、现在很多前端工程师是从后端转过来的~ 我的结论:如果想看借来或蹲书店花几个小时过一遍就行了  (展开)
蜗居邮箱 2010-07-20 20:06:22

结构清晰,深入浅出

逻辑分明,结构清晰,深入浅出: “Web标准由一系列标准组合而成,其核心理念就是将网页的结构、样式和行为分离开来,所以它可以分为三大部分:结构标准、样式标准和行为标准...”  (展开)
newsarah 2010-07-20 18:11:09

长期开发实践的经验总结

CSS、HTML、JavaScript这三种前端开发语言的特点是不同的,对代码质量的要求也是不同的,但它们之间又有着千丝万缕的联系。 这本书离有很多开发的思想和原则,应该都是在长期开发实践中积累下来的。 (来自卓越)  (展开)
楼兰 2016-01-22 09:23:45

益处多于坏处

这本书,差评和好评对半分吧。主要的评论参照来自于亚马逊。 大家差评是源于书中的一些错误,有些内容的错误性,但是也大多是辩证的来观察的,对于书中代码组织,模块划分大多没有意义,所以这部分是值得参考的。 其余关于 css 和 js 的细节部分,实践过程中还需要详细考证。 ...  (展开)
小V 2014-09-15 13:10:16

读了肯定是有收获的

自己的水平还是学习阶段,读了肯定是有收获的,让自己有了解了一些自己不知道的东西,好好学习 web前端开发工程师小V  (展开)
seasmiles 2013-04-09 00:58:56

第五部分思路不对嘛

都是以照顾IE7,8为主,顺便兼容W3C标准。 比如:e=window.event || e; el=e.srcElement || e.target; 所以在chrome及众“国内自主研发处理器”大行其道的年代,这本书显得过时了。 这部分的组织也比较混乱,比如上面的浏览器事件兼容处理放到了“JS分层”这小节里。 正本书有...  (展开)
Hedgehog 2013-03-27 22:04:37

为何IE6-8不支持DOM对象继承Object的prototype自定义方法

Object.prototype.say = function(){alert(1)} function fun(){} fun.say(); //1 var li = document.getElementsByTagName("li"); alert(typeof li[0]); //Object li[0].say(); //IE6-8不支持 所以想知道原因,和解决办法(如何兼容:获取到的DOM对象可以使用Object...  (展开)
[已注销] 2011-12-16 20:38:56

问:关于作者P50中推荐的base.css文件

这篇书评可能有关键情节透露

作者推荐的bass.css文件,本人是仅有3个月经验的前端,想问关于这个文件一些代码的意思; 感觉这个文件中最需要弄懂的一段代码(因为涉及不懂的东西基本是最多的,但用处其实对我来说应该是比较大的)是: .clearfix:after {content:"."; display:block; height:0; clear:both...  (展开)
2011-09-05 11:35:14

纸上得来终觉浅,绝知此事要躬行

P143 页,命名空间的函数 GLOBAL.namespace=function(str){ var arr=str.split("."),o=GLOBAL; for (var i=(arr[0]="GLOBAL") ? 1 : 0;i<arr.length;i++){ o[arr[i]=o[arr[i] || {}; o=o[arr[i]; } ...  (展开)
一步一个脚印 2011-07-27 09:22:50

对我有帮助

作者把日常工作中的经验与解决问题的思路进行整理总结并写了上去,通过本书使我对前端尤其是css这块有一个新的认识,css写出来非常容易但真正写到让别的同事能一目了然,在今后的运维过程中能再一次的非常清晰的读懂,这可不是个简简单单活.  (展开)
不辞 2010-12-09 15:34:03

楼上的确吹毛求疵

将面向对象的思想应用在前端开发我也是看了这本书才知道,老实说,我十分的佩服,对于CSS分离,分离到什么程度是一直没有一个知道思想,起码用这种思想我能得到一些启发  (展开)
木小乐 2010-11-03 15:54:35

这本书说的不是技术。

1.主要是讲关于前端开发流程的思考。 2.前端不只单是技术。某些习惯和方式也很重要。 3.在某些结构安排和代码写法上的确很有启发。  (展开)
IanChan 2010-10-14 19:37:22

今天到的书!

今天到的书,两天半就到了,送货速度还不错! 随便翻了翻,发现有些是彩页,内容大概有了解一下,感觉一般。。。  (展开)
newsarah 2010-07-27 13:56:49

精简、重用、有序

所谓高质量的代码,在Web标准的思想指导下,实现结构、样式和行为分离的基础上,还要做到三点:精简、重用、有序。  (展开)
newsarah 2010-07-27 13:53:31

侧重讲解技巧,实用性很强!

这本书的重点不在于讲解“技术”,而是更侧重于“技巧”的讲解。 融入了作者一线工作中的体会,实用性很强! (来自卓越)  (展开)
itlinux201 2010-07-20 19:43:16

人际交往很重要

“工程师往往都是更专注于技术的,不太善于处理人际关系。比起复杂的人,大多数工程师往往更喜欢非黑即白,非0即1,非true即false的代码。学会与人相处也是工程师们必要的一个课程,它的重要性甚至超过技术本身。” ——深有同感,有的时候人际交往大于技术本身!  (展开)
cmphz 2010-07-20 17:43:09

拨云见日,逃离纷杂的知识体系

看似简单的网页制作,如果要做得更好、更专业,真的是不简单。让很多人困惑! 这么纷杂的知识体系让新手学习起来无从下手,对于老手来说,也时常不知道下一步该学什么。 这本书帮到了我。推荐一下! (来自当当)  (展开)
ITinchia 2010-07-20 17:34:14

打造高质量的Web前端

目前市面关于Web前端开发的书主要都是针对单一技术的,而本书是以打造高质量的Web前端为目标,讲解如何通过编写高质量的前端代码来实现这一目标。这其实才是前端开发工程师真正想学的。 ——这也正是我看这本书的原因! (来自当当)  (展开)
<前页 1 2 后页> (共28条)

订阅编写高质量代码的书评